From: Steve Sutton Date: Wed, 5 Oct 2016 20:33:53 +0000 (-0400) Subject: Updating the member admin client user dashboard widget X-Git-Tag: v2.7.0^2~1^2~3 X-Git-Url: http://cvs2.gaslightmedia.com/gitweb/?a=commitdiff_plain;h=c3be4ee0832de194e6fd4e204610bda950ba326d;p=WP-Plugins%2Fglm-member-db.git Updating the member admin client user dashboard widget Listing out the pending member profiles. --- diff --git a/models/admin/dashboard/members.php b/models/admin/dashboard/members.php index f27050c3..2842bbe1 100644 --- a/models/admin/dashboard/members.php +++ b/models/admin/dashboard/members.php @@ -13,7 +13,7 @@ * @version 0.1 */ -require_once GLM_MEMBERS_PLUGIN_CLASS_PATH . '/data/dataMembers.php'; +require_once GLM_MEMBERS_PLUGIN_CLASS_PATH . '/data/dataMemberInfo.php'; /** * Dashboard Class Model @@ -21,7 +21,7 @@ require_once GLM_MEMBERS_PLUGIN_CLASS_PATH . '/data/dataMembers.php'; * Each Add-On can have one or more dashboards. */ -class GlmMembersAdmin_dashboard_members extends GlmDataMembers +class GlmMembersAdmin_dashboard_members extends GlmDataMemberInfo { /** * Word Press Database Object @@ -100,8 +100,13 @@ class GlmMembersAdmin_dashboard_members extends GlmDataMembers $success = true; + $where = "T.status =" . $this->config['status_numb']['Pending']; + $memberInfoRecords = $this->getList( $where ); + //echo '
$memberInfoRecords: ' . print_r( $memberInfoRecords, true ) . '
'; + // Compile template data. $templateData = array( + 'memberInfoRecords' => $memberInfoRecords ); // Return status, suggested view, and data to controller. diff --git a/views/admin/dashboard/members.html b/views/admin/dashboard/members.html index 67cf37c0..276e173d 100644 --- a/views/admin/dashboard/members.html +++ b/views/admin/dashboard/members.html @@ -4,8 +4,23 @@ Pending {$terms.term_member_cap} Profiles
- Members Pending list - + {if $memberInfoRecords} + + {/if}
diff --git a/views/admin/members/index.html b/views/admin/members/index.html index d5cc8b23..d0aef572 100644 --- a/views/admin/members/index.html +++ b/views/admin/members/index.html @@ -86,7 +86,6 @@ {if $manage_members}
- Member Manager Dashboards goes here {apply_filters('glm-member-db-dashboard-member-admin-widgets', '')}
{else}